Creamy Strawberry Shortcake Overnight Oats

Chilled rolled oats combined with velvety Greek yogurt and fresh strawberries for a creamy, cake-like texture that feels like a decadent morning treat.

NUTRITION

457kcal
Protein
44.2g
Fat
6.1g
Carbs
58.7g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

0.5 cup rolled oats

1 cup non-fat Greek yogurt

0.5 scoop vanilla protein powder

0.5 cup unsweetened almond milk

1 cup fresh strawberries

1 tsp chia seeds

0.5 tsp vanilla extract

0.5 tbsp pure maple syrup

0.13 tsp sea salt

PREPARATION

  • 1

    In a glass mason jar, whisk together the rolled oats, vanilla protein powder, chia seeds, and sea salt until well combined.

  • 2

    Add the Greek yogurt, almond milk, vanilla extract, and maple syrup, stirring vigorously to ensure no protein powder clumps remain.

  • 3

    Gently fold in half of the sliced strawberries to distribute their natural sweetness throughout the mixture.

  • 4

    Secure the lid and refrigerate for at least 4 hours or overnight, allowing the oats to absorb the liquid and become thick.

  • 5

    Top with the remaining fresh strawberries just before serving for a burst of bright flavor.
